EU Elections 2024: The first update from the Ministry of the Interior – 178,588 voted by postal vote

There will be a safe assessment of the result at 21:00

Newsroom June 9 10:25

The first briefing on the European elections was given shortly before 8 am by the Deputy Minister of the Interior, Theodoros Livanios.

After stating that the elections are being held without problems and after thanking those participating in the electoral process, Mr. Livanios said that a total of 18,380 polling stations have been set up throughout the territory and are waiting for voters until 7 pm when the polls close.

The Deputy Minister of the Interior, Theodoros Livanios, said that 178,588 voted by mail.

Specifically, Mr. Livanios said: “The process has started since 7 am throughout the territory and is progressing smoothly, with any minor problems that have been identified having been resolved in cooperation with the representatives of the judicial authority and the Municipalities. Voting takes place in 18,380 polling stations in total throughout Greece.” In fact, he emphasized the importance of “know where you are voting” to avoid inconvenience.

Furthermore, the General Superintendent for Monitoring the Postal Vote process, Supreme Court judge Christos Katsigiannis, issued an act by which he verified the completion of the postal vote collection process. “A total of 178,588 files voted, of which 136,451 correspond to residents abroad and 42,137 to residents abroad,” he said.

Regarding the postal voting process, he added that “yesterday afternoon (06/08), after the completion of the vote collection, the voters, who did not send a file or were not received in time, were informed, in order to exercise from today on 11 in the morning until 7 in the evening their right to vote at the polling station, where they vote”. Also, Christos Katsigiannis added the following: “All the other voters, who participated and had applied for a postal vote and sent and received their file on time, they have a special indication in the electoral roll and cannot exercise their right to vote” .

Regarding the update on the progress of the electoral process, he also emphasized: “Around 13:45 the Ministry of the Interior will give a first estimate of the participation based on the data that the judicial representatives have transmitted. The same will happen at 14:45 and 17:45. At 19:00 the process is completed and immediately after we wait for the official flow of the results. In any case, around 21:00 the estimate will give the estimate of the election result and the number of seats per party”.
